Hurricane Helene winds increase to 140 mph
Hurricane Helene has grown stronger as it nears landfall, with sustained winds of 140 mph, according to the National Weather Service.
As of 9 p.m. ET, the hurricane was 65 miles west of Cedar Key, Florida, and 90 miles south of Tallahassee.
The hurricane is moving at 24 mph and is still on track to make landfall between 10 p.m. and 11 p.m. ET.
